A study of the risk factors associated with mastitis in Sri Lankan dairy cattle was conducted to inform risk reduction activities to improve the quality and quantity of milk production and dairy farmer income. A cross-sectional survey of randomly selected dairy farms was undertaken to investigate 12 cow and 39 herd level and management risk factors in the Central Province. The farm level prevalence of mastitis (clinical and subclinical) was 48 %, similar to what has been found elsewhere in South and Southeast Asia. A profile off the penicillin concentration in bovine conjunctival sac fluid (CF) was determined after a single subconjunctival injection of procaine penicillin (6 x 10(5) iu in 2ml). When the injection was made through the skin of the upper eye lid, the duration of therapeutic concentration was significantly greater (P<0.01) than when the injection had been given by the perconjunctival route: approximately 68 hours or 40 hours respectively. These findings support the clinical use of subconjunctivally administered procaine penicillin in the treatment of infectious bovine keratoconjunctivitis. Black tiger shrimp Penaeus monodon farming is important for Sri Lanka's rural development plans. Consumer confidence is critical for the development and maintenance of export and domestic shrimp markets. Public concern about the use of antimicrobial drugs and chemicals on shrimp farms, however, could threaten market access. We sought to identify high-risk areas and farm-level risk factors for antimicrobial use to inform the core messages and strategic placement of extension programs to help farmers develop best management practices for antimicrobial use. We undertook a survey of 603 operating farms within the Puttalam district over 42 weeks. Lower stocking density and early harvest were associated with a lower risk of antimicrobial use, whereas standard management practices, including water treatment, feed supplements, probiotic use, pond fertilizing, disinfectant use, and pesticide use, were associated with increased risk. Spatial cluster detection found three significant clusters of antimicrobial-using farms. Antimicrobials were more likely to be used in areas with lower farm density. Some of our counterintuitive findings are discussed from a socioecological perspective. A comprehensive understanding of why antimicrobials are used on shrimp farms requires an evaluation of the physical, epidemiological, and socioeconomic factors.  相似文献

Background

Histochemical staining of plant tissues with 4-dimethylaminocinnamaldehyde (DMACA) or vanillin-HCl is widely used to characterize spatial patterns of proanthocyanidin accumulation in plant tissues. These methods are limited in their ability to allow high-resolution imaging of proanthocyanidin deposits.

Results

Tissue embedding techniques were used in combination with DMACA staining to analyze the accumulation of proanthocyanidins in Lotus corniculatus (L.) and Trifolium repens (L.) tissues. Embedding of plant tissues in LR White or paraffin matrices, with or without DMACA staining, preserved the physical integrity of the plant tissues, allowing high-resolution imaging that facilitated cell-specific localization of proanthocyanidins. A brown coloration was seen in proanthocyanidin-producing cells when plant tissues were embedded without DMACA staining and this was likely to have been due to non-enzymatic oxidation of proanthocyanidins and the formation of colored semiquinones and quinones.

Conclusions

This paper presents a simple, high-resolution method for analysis of proanthocyanidin accumulation in organs, tissues and cells of two plant species with different patterns of proanthocyanidin accumulation, namely Lotus corniculatus (birdsfoot trefoil) and Trifolium repens (white clover). This technique was used to characterize cell type-specific patterns of proanthocyanidin accumulation in white clover flowers at different stages of development.  相似文献

Twenty-five of 40 red deer (Cervus elaphus) exhibited corneal opacities and ulceration resembling mild bovine infectious keratitis. Attempts to incriminate either a bacterial or viral causal agent were unsuccessful.

Subconjunctival injections of a penicillin/streptomycin mixture were administered in both eyes of affected and in-contact animals. Resolution over an 8 week period was uneventful.  相似文献
